I'm just getting around to writing this review because my other winter boots finally failed, and I was forced to wear the Bean boots again. The other boots were a pair of [redacted] from the late 90's and they were laid to rest after the rubber lowers failed beyond repair. Note they never separated from the leather uppers, unlike our friend here.
Within the first season of light use, these Bean boots separated at the leather upper / rubber lower junction. I see many others have had the same issue. Now they're my only pair of winter boots, so I can't ship them back and be without them for the season. I'm forced to wear waterproof socks with the boots when I'm in snow. My hopes were high when I purchased these, and they've unfortunately been nothing but a disappointment.
Sizing: Size one full size down from your Vans, if you're buying the unlined version. The fit with waterproof socks will be great, until the rubber digs into your ankle bone.

Honestly these were what I could get for my husband who's been wearing the 10 inch version for 45 years. We have been trying to buy the 10 inch model for over 2 years & recently found out you'll be discontinuing this boot model ( I think in all the heights.)which makes us very sad. The hunting boot is good but the soul is softer(prob. to make it quieter) and wears out sooner. He is a forester & wildlife biologist so these are 2 - 3 season boots for him and he covers a lot of ground in a year. We will probably have to look for an alternate boot for him before these wear out & I don't think your current selection has something as suitable as this boot so will have to look elsewhere. We are indeed sad that these staples he has relied on for 45 years won't be available anymore. We know change happens and you have to be flexible, but sometimes it's a real bummer! The lower rating was just because he couldn't get the 10 inch model. No structural problems as far as he could tell. It's great that he can get them in Wide. Thanks for having them for all these years.

Glad I could find these in 13 N. My first pair of LLB boots. They are the classic duck boot so not much you can say about the style. I will only be wearing them in snow and slushy weather so hopefully they will last a long time. They do feel wider than a usual narrow sized shoe. A true narrow will lace evenly across the foot without scrunching up the fabric. Unfortunately these do cause folding of the fabric when the laces are tightened and there is side to side space inside. Still a better fit than a traditional snow boot with medium width.
